Hi Jan:

Lyrica is kind of the new Neurontin (not sure on

spelling) and they act on nerve pain, such as that

caused by diabetic peripheral neuropathies. They have

been found to be effective in treating similiar pain

suffered by people with fibromyalgia. It has helped

with my nerve pain, especially night time pain, but I

still have to wake up when some pain begins in the leg

I am laying on, and adjust my body position from one

hip to another, accompanied by my body pillow, to keep

the pain in my legs from starting up. But it has

helped, and when I was without it for two weeks, I

really noticed an increase in my leg pain. It works

well for me, but may not for you, but definately ask

your doctor about it.
